Singari Protected Forest Area village is located in the Dhekiajuli Subdivision of the Sonitpur district in the Assam.
Singari Protected Forest Area has a total population of 69 people, out of which the male population is 49 while the female population is 20. The literacy rate of Singari Protected Forest Area village is 69.57%, out of which 81.63% males and 40.00% females are literate. There are about 15 houses in Singari Protected Forest Area village.
